for a while i attended holly bank private school just outside of chester. it was located in a big house that had been converted. at the top of the drive was a small cottage the i assume was once a gate house. i remember a large fire place in the entrance hall and one of the class rooms being so small you could only fit 8 desks in (probably used to be servants quarters).the school was later changed to a religious studies collage and from looking on google maps now it looks like houses have been built on what was the play ground and playing field. does anybody else have memories of holly bank or even better know where i could find information/pictures about the house it used to be. thanks.

Posted By: bert1 Re: holly bank chester. - 8th Oct 2016 8:46am
The schools full address was,

Holly Bank School,
Abbot's Hayes,
Liverpool Rd,
Chester.

Abbot's Hayes consisted of 4 large properties, 1 to 4 and Abbot's Hayes Lodge.
The properties had between 11 and 14 rooms, the lodge having only about 5.

Abbot's Hayes and the lodge appear in numerous directories and census up to at least 1923.

Holly Bank school appearing in the 1940 telephone book suggests it opened between 1923 and 1940. Being able to find numbers 2, 3 and 4 in various telephone books also suggests the school was Number 1, Abbot's Hayes, approximately a 12 room house when it was residential.
